Job description

zHealth is a fast growing SaaS company. We use cutting edge technology to digitize wellness businesses. We are growing fast as we help simplify the practices of wellness offices around the US and are looking for our next set of team members to help us grow further!


*This role is 100% in office in San Francisco*

What are we looking for:

As a Sales Development Representative (SDR), you will be part of an experienced sales team that takes care of new potential clients, leading the process through qualification, education and needs analysis. This role focuses on developing your business and sales skills as an SDR at zHealth. The Sales Development Representative role is an individual contributor position working to expand zHealth's client base. You will be working along-side fellow Sales Development Representatives and Account Executives. Your role will be seeking new business opportunities by contacting and developing relationships with potential customers. We are looking for someone who is self-driven, hungry to learn, and join a high growth organization. This role is a great opportunity for someone who has some sales experience.

Requirements

    • (Must) Outstanding communication skills;
    • (Must) Not afraid of rejection and dealing with objections;
    • (Must) Open-minded and self success oriented;
    • (Must) Experience with cold outreach, especially cold calling;
    • (Nice to have) Experience in working with sales targets and having a good track record of accomplishing them;
    • (Nice to have) Experience in using tools such as Salesforce and Outreach.
    • Have ambition and hustle with a learning mindset
    • Ability to connect with people deeply

Benefits

  • You’ll be launching a career at a fast growing SaaS company!
  • Stock options
  • 401K Match
  • Medical, dental, and vision coverage
  • Paid Time Off
